Senior Living Magazine: A Comprehensive Guide to 55+ Lifestyle
Senior Living Magazine is a popular monthly magazine that caters to the lifestyle and interests of people aged 55 and above in British Columbia. The magazine is known for its informative articles, engaging stories, and beautiful photography that showcase the lives of seniors in BC.
The magazine covers a wide range of topics that are relevant to seniors, including health and wellness, travel, food and drink, entertainment, finance, technology, home improvement, and more. Each issue features expert advice from professionals in various fields who provide valuable insights on how seniors can live their best lives.
One of the unique aspects of Senior Living Magazine is its focus on local content. The magazine features stories about people living in BC communities such as Victoria, Vancouver Island North, Nanaimo & Central Island Region etc., which helps readers connect with their neighbors and learn about what's happening in their area.
In addition to its print publication Senior Living Magazine also has an online presence through its website where readers can access digital versions of the magazine as well as additional content such as blogs posts videos etc. This makes it easy for seniors who prefer digital media to stay up-to-date with news related to their age group.
